Is Hadoop a NoSQL?

Hadoop is not a type of database, but rather a software ecosystem that allows for massively parallel computing. It is an enabler of certain types NoSQL distributed databases (such as HBase), which can allow for data to be spread across thousands of servers with little reduction in performance.
Takedown request   |   View complete answer on datajobs.com


What is difference between Hadoop and NoSQL?

But whereas NoSQL is a distributed database infrastructure that can handle the heavy demands of big data, Hadoop is a file system that allows for massively parallel computing. Using MapReduce, Hadoop distributes a dataset among multiple servers and operates on that data.
Takedown request   |   View complete answer on toolbox.com


Is HBase NoSQL?

What is HBase? Apache HBase is a column-oriented, NoSQL database built on top of Hadoop (HDFS, to be exact). It is an open source implementation of Google's Bigtable paper. HBase is a top-level Apache project and just released its 1.0 release after many years of development.
Takedown request   |   View complete answer on thenewstack.io


Is Hadoop a relational database?

Unlike Relational Database Management System (RDBMS), we cannot call Hadoop a database, but it is more of a distributed file system that can store and process a huge volume of data sets across a cluster of computers. Hadoop has two major components: HDFS (Hadoop Distributed File System) and MapReduce.
Takedown request   |   View complete answer on tdan.com


Is Big Data same as NoSQL?

NoSQL is a better choice for businesses whose data workloads are more geared toward the rapid processing and analyzing of vast amounts of varied and unstructured data, aka Big Data. Unlike relational databases, NoSQL databases are not bound by the confines of a fixed schema model.
Takedown request   |   View complete answer on qubole.com


NoSQL vs. SQL and Hadoop



What is Hadoop in big data?

Apache Hadoop is an open source framework that is used to efficiently store and process large datasets ranging in size from gigabytes to petabytes of data. Instead of using one large computer to store and process the data, Hadoop allows clustering multiple computers to analyze massive datasets in parallel more quickly.
Takedown request   |   View complete answer on aws.amazon.com


Which is best NoSQL database?

With that said, let's check out these Open-Source NoSQL Databases and find out some of their specifications.
  • MongoDB. ...
  • Neo4j. ...
  • Apache CouchDB. ...
  • OrientDB. ...
  • Riak. ...
  • Redis. ...
  • RavenDB. ...
  • Hypertable. Hypertable is NoSQL open-source database that was designed to combat the scalability problem that appears in all the relational databases.
Takedown request   |   View complete answer on geeksforgeeks.org


What kind of DB is Hadoop?

Hadoop is not a type of database, but rather a software ecosystem that allows for massively parallel computing. It is an enabler of certain types NoSQL distributed databases (such as HBase), which can allow for data to be spread across thousands of servers with little reduction in performance.
Takedown request   |   View complete answer on datajobs.com


What is difference between Hadoop and MongoDB?

MongoDB is a NoSQL database, whereas Hadoop is a framework for storing & processing Big Data in a distributed environment. MongoDB is a document oriented NoSQL database. MongoDB stores data in flexible JSON like document format.
Takedown request   |   View complete answer on edureka.co


Does Hadoop use SQL?

SQL-on-Hadoop is a class of analytical application tools that combine established SQL-style querying with newer Hadoop data framework elements. By supporting familiar SQL queries, SQL-on-Hadoop lets a wider group of enterprise developers and business analysts work with Hadoop on commodity computing clusters.
Takedown request   |   View complete answer on techtarget.com


Is MongoDB a NoSQL?

MongoDB is an open source NoSQL database management program. NoSQL is used as an alternative to traditional relational databases. NoSQL databases are quite useful for working with large sets of distributed data. MongoDB is a tool that can manage document-oriented information, store or retrieve information.
Takedown request   |   View complete answer on techtarget.com


Is Oracle a NoSQL database?

Oracle NoSQL Database Cloud Service makes it easy for developers to build applications using document, columnar and key-value database models, delivering predictable single digit millisecond response times with data replication for high availability.
Takedown request   |   View complete answer on oracle.com


Is PostgreSQL is NoSQL?

PostgreSQL is a traditional RDBMS (relational database management system) SQL database, like Oracle and MySQL. PostgreSQL is free. MongoDB is a no-schema, noSQL, JSON database. MongoDB has a free version, but they also have hosted and enterprise paid versions.
Takedown request   |   View complete answer on bmc.com


Is Hadoop a data lake?

A Hadoop data lake is a data management platform comprising one or more Hadoop clusters. It is used principally to process and store nonrelational data, such as log files, internet clickstream records, sensor data, JSON objects, images and social media posts.
Takedown request   |   View complete answer on techtarget.com


Why is Hadoop not a database?

Hadoop is not a database storage or relational storage. It is mainly used for processing huge amounts of data on distributed servers. It stores files in HDFS (Hadoop distributed file system) but does not qualify as a relational database. Relational databases store information in tables defined by the specific schema.
Takedown request   |   View complete answer on data-flair.training


Is Hadoop a data warehouse?

Hadoop boasts of a similar architecture as MPP data warehouses, but with some obvious differences. Unlike Data warehouse which defines a parallel architecture, hadoop's architecture comprises of processors who are loosely coupled across a Hadoop cluster. Each cluster can work on different data sources.
Takedown request   |   View complete answer on towardsdatascience.com


Can MongoDB replace Hadoop?

It's a general-purpose database. MongoDB can be used with data lakes and unstructured data, just like Hadoop. In addition to that, it has a rich query language and can replace any RDBMS, while Hadoop needs to be used in conjunction with a database.
Takedown request   |   View complete answer on mongodb.com


What is Apache Spark vs Hadoop?

It's a top-level Apache project focused on processing data in parallel across a cluster, but the biggest difference is that it works in memory. Whereas Hadoop reads and writes files to HDFS, Spark processes data in RAM using a concept known as an RDD, Resilient Distributed Dataset.
Takedown request   |   View complete answer on geeksforgeeks.org


Does Hadoop use MongoDB?

MongoDB powers the online, real time operational application, serving business processes and end-users, exposing analytics models created by Hadoop to operational processes. Hadoop consumes data from MongoDB, blending it with data from other sources to generate sophisticated analytics and machine learning models.
Takedown request   |   View complete answer on mongodb.com


What is NoSQL database in big data?

NoSQL databases store data in documents rather than relational tables. Accordingly, we classify them as "not only SQL" and subdivide them by a variety of flexible data models. Types of NoSQL databases include pure document databases, key-value stores, wide-column databases, and graph databases.
Takedown request   |   View complete answer on couchbase.com


Is spark SQL or NoSQL?

Couchbase has offered a Spark Connector for its NoSQL database for over a year. Just as other NoSQL vendors, Couchbase's Spark connector enables Couchbase data to be materialized as Spark DataFrames and Datasets, which makes that data available to Spark's SQL, machine learning, and graph APIs.
Takedown request   |   View complete answer on datanami.com


Is Hadoop structured or unstructured data?

Incompatibly Structured Data (But they call it Unstructured)

Hadoop has an abstraction layer called Hive which we use to process this structured data.
Takedown request   |   View complete answer on ovaledge.com


What are the 4 types of NoSQL databases?

But NoSQL databases are all quite different from each other as well. This article will describe the four main types of NoSQL databases and their uses.
...
Here are the four main types of NoSQL databases:
  • Document databases.
  • Key-value stores.
  • Column-oriented databases.
  • Graph databases.
Takedown request   |   View complete answer on mongodb.com


Which is not a NoSQL database?

Which of the following is not a NoSQL database? Explanation: Microsoft SQL Server is a relational database management system developed by Microsoft.
Takedown request   |   View complete answer on sanfoundry.com


What are examples of NoSQL databases?

MongoDB, CouchDB, CouchBase, Cassandra, HBase, Redis, Riak, Neo4J are the popular NoSQL databases examples. MongoDB, CouchDB, CouchBase , Amazon SimpleDB, Riak, Lotus Notes are Document-oriented NoSQL databases.
Takedown request   |   View complete answer on bigdataanalyticsnews.com
Previous question
How many eyelids does a human have?